VIS Assigns Initial Broker Management Rating to Darson Securities Limited

Karachi, December 29, 2020 (PPI-OT): VIS Credit Rating Company Ltd. (VIS) has assigned initial Broker Management Rating of ‘BMR2’ to Darson Securities Limited (DSL). Outlook on the assigned rating is ‘Stable’. The rating signifies strong external control framework, sound risk management and compliance and sound HR and IT policies. Client relationship, supervision over regulatory requirements and financial management are considered adequate.

Assigned rating reflects DSL’s strong governance over external control environment along with sound HR and IT management policies. Formation of board level risk management committee and inclusion of independent director with relevant experience would enhance corporate governance. Rating takes note of sound risk management and compliance levels and good relationship with local and intuitional clients.

Assessment of financial profile indicates increase in core brokerage income (owing to uptick in trading volumes) during FY20 however; higher administrative expenses (more than two-fold increase in salaries and commissions) led to loss at year-end. Going forward, diversity in income stream from other than brokerage would lower operational risk.
